Tom Poston Trivia



Ex-father-in-law of George S. Clinton. (imdb.com)

Child (with Jean Sullivan): daughter Francesca Poston. (imdb.com)

Father of Jason Poston and daughter Hudson by his second wife Kay Hudson. (imdb.com)

Former acrobat with the Flying Zepleys. (imdb.com)

Made money as a boxer during his teen years. (imdb.com)

Next door neighbor of Shane Stanley in mid seventies. (imdb.com)

Together with Louis Nye and Don Knotts, he was a regular cast member of "The Steve Allen Show" (1956) television program. The trio performed the recurring "Man on the Street" skits. (imdb.com)

Has an older sister who made a mystery guest appearance on "To Tell the Truth" (1956) (imdb.com)

Is allergic to onions. (imdb.com)

Served in the U.S. Air Corps from 1941 to 1945, flew over Europe on D-Day, and left the service with an Oak Leaf Cluster of medals. Oak leaf cluster is a devise that is attached to the ribbon (award). It denotes or signifies the person has received the same award more than once. There are silver or bronze in color. Each bronze counts for one, silver counts for five. (imdb.com)

Was originally under contract to play Maxwell Smart ("Agent 86") in the show "Get Smart" (1965). (imdb.com)

Born at 9:40pm-EST (imdb.com)

Spouse: Suzanne Pleshette (11 May 2001 - 30 April 2007) (his death) Kay Hudson (30 December 1980 - 10 July 1998) (her death) Kay Hudson (8 June 1968 - 1975) (divorced) 2 children Jean Sullivan (1955 - 1968) (divorced) 1 child (imdb.com)
